VIDEOS: Kansas State fans storm the court after upset win over Kansas
Scott Sewell-USA TODAY Sports
Kansas State fans could not contain their joy as time ran out at Monday night's game.
After the Wildcats toppled No. 8 Kansas 70-63, spectators stormed the court, effectively trampling their beloved players and the opponents.
Jayhawks forward Jamari Traylor seemed less than amused, understandably.
Twitter hypothesizes that this man in a suit executing a headlock on a fan may be a Kansas assistant.
Kansas head coach Bill Self wasn't pleased about the storming of the court, saying he felt his players were put in danger. "This has got to stop," he said.
